Transaction d25e607a8d8991e42652199942666770d3f46135f76efba3402e97434e1c550d

1 Input
2 Outputs
  • d25e607a8d8991e42652199942666770d3f46135f76efba3402e97434e1c550d:0
  • value  22933178
    address  1Hpx8XzRoyfCouncBa4yrFmWYdAASDwcpP
  • d25e607a8d8991e42652199942666770d3f46135f76efba3402e97434e1c550d:1
  • value  420734
    address  155HDgAfivmQXydTyHMi1K6PEFgKvhJjAm